Biography

Henry George Symonds (24 June 1889 – 1 January 1945), known as Harry Symonds, was a Welsh cricketer who played first-class cricket for Glamorgan and Wales in the 1920s, having made one previous first-class appearance, for South Wales, in 1912. Symonds had played for Glamorgan at minor counties level since 1908, while he also played one minor match for Devon in 1924.
